Add transparency support for LightmapGI Currently when baking lightmaps users have to choose between transparent objects casting shadows as if they were fully opaque, or not casting shadows at all. This has been a major limitation in both the quality of lightmap baking and the ergonomics of the lightmap baking workflow.

In gameengines (or even when exported from the 3D modelling application), animation data is baked to a simpler representation because, for games, processing beziers and IKs is way too expensive for real-time. Just decoding the animation, however, is not enough.

RTX Global Illumination (RTXGI) Leveraging the power of ray tracing, the RTX Global Illumination (RTXGI) SDK provides scalable solutions to compute multi-bounce indirect lighting without bake times, light leaks, or expensive per-frame costs.
